About Iron Bridge Park

Located along Iron Bridge Park Road in nearby Moody, Texas, Iron Bridge Park serves as a scenic outdoor escape situated right on the river. Holding a 3.8-star rating from 107 Google reviews, this quiet destination attracts outdoor enthusiasts and locals seeking a spot for family fishing, camping, or an afternoon barbecue. Visitors frequently highlight the area's peaceful natural beauty, which comes alive with lush spring growth, colorful wildflower blooms, fluttering butterflies, and a diverse variety of bird species enjoying the riverbank habitat.

For those planning an overnight visit, the grounds operate as a simple dry camp equipped with four covered picnic tables and two vault toilets. While travelers should be prepared for rough access trails and craters in the roadway when driving down toward the water, the park continues to be noted for its ongoing upkeep and natural appeal. Whether casting a line into the river or relaxing at a shaded picnic table, it offers a rustic, laid-back setting in the greater Waco area.

Lovely little park, very simple dry-camp with 4 covered picnic tables and two valt-toilets. There are so many bird species utilizing the lush spring growth right on the river. And don't get me started on the spring wildflower blooms and their beautiful pollinators (butterflies!) I stayed Saturday and Sunday over Easter weekend and didn't have much company except some evening fishermen and an occasional drive-through lookie-loo. As is too often the case, this site seems to be a local dumping ground. I found tires, paint cans, diapers, and plenty of metal that tells the tail of generations of disrespect. Suffice to say, it was difficult to nab a few pictures without including the refuse. Sad, sad, sad.
